Output e6663e236ff35c8c5443c7d34ccb3a9deb46b4a5f956dc894f6070567f689c28:0

value
14483162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bee7a00df5eae234884c1584e5d6c5223d640b8 OP_EQUAL
address
3ESuXrKYDiVkpsqP5mdoAVfkmT8tUEoteh
transaction
e6663e236ff35c8c5443c7d34ccb3a9deb46b4a5f956dc894f6070567f689c28
spent
true